Questions
- Which country in North America has the highest inflation?
- Haiti has the highest inflation in North America: +28.6% a year (2025). Next come Honduras (+4.6% a year) and Jamaica (+4.0% a year).
- Which country in North America has the lowest inflation?
- Panama, with −0.2% a year (2025).
- What is the typical inflation of a country in North America?
- The median of the 22 countries in North America is +1.8% a year: half are above it, half below. The median, not the average, because a few countries at the top would drag an average far above almost everyone.
